Perspective on how well we played in the SB

49ers regular season scoring average: 29.9 points
49ers score in the Super Bowl: 20 points
Net: -9.9 points

Chiefs regular season scoring average: 28.2 points
Chiefs score in the Super Bowl: 31 points
Net: +3.2 points

49ers regular season defense scoring average: 19.4 points
49ers defensive scoring in the Super Bowl: 31 points
Net: +11.6

Chiefs regular season defense scoring average: 19.3
Chiefs defensive scoring in the Super Bowl: 20
Net: +0.7 points

Our Chiefs pretty much met or exceeded their regular season performance against one of the best offensive and defensive teams in the NFL.

While we forced the 49ers to significantly underperform their regular season performance by two scores on both sides of the ball.

The Chiefs made the plays they needed to, the 49'ers did not.

-Mahomes 3rd and 15 long pass to Tyreek
-49'er pass rusher just misses Mahomes as he unloads pass to Tyreek
-Chris Jones batting down a pass to a wide open Kittle late in the game that would have given the 49'ers a first around the 50.
-Jimmy G's long pass to an open Emanuel Sanders just 3-4 feet too long to go ahead with a little over a minute to go in the game.
-Damien Williams sticking the ball out as he is going out of bounds to score the go-ahead TD
-Chiefs D has their first 3 and out late in the game to prevent 49'ers running out the clock
-Richard Sherman gets burnt like toast on a great move by Watkins and PMII drops a dime in stride

These plays late in the 4th QTR are why the Chiefs won and the 49'ers lost.
